Even when it's safe to reuse oil, remember that if someone has a fish/seafood allergy, they can be harmed by eating something cooked in oil previously used for fish or seafood. We always keep oil used for fish or seafood separate from oil used for other foods. And, it's actually a regulation here in foodservice that a ...

Place your fish oil capsule container in the refrigerator immediately after opening. Make sure the lid has been tightly sealed and is as close to airtight as possible. WebOct 29, 2024 · Refrigerated: use the oil in about 6-8 months after opening. Not refrigerated: use the oil in about 3-4 months after opening.
